[DevExpress]GridControl 根据RowIndex和VisibleColumnsIndex来获取单元格值

关键代码:

        /// <summary>
        /// 根据rowIndex和visibleColumnsIndex来获取单元格可见值
        /// </summary>
        /// <param name="view">GridView</param>
        /// <param name="rowIndex">rowIndex</param>
        /// <param name="visibleColumnsIndex">visibleColumnsIndex</param>
        /// <returns>单元格可见值</returns>
        public static string GetRowCellDisplayText(this GridView view, int rowIndex, int visibleColumnsIndex)
        {
            return view.GetRowCellDisplayText(rowIndex, view.VisibleColumns[visibleColumnsIndex]);
        }
        /// <summary>
        /// 根据rowIndex和visibleColumnsIndex来获取单元格值
        /// </summary>
        /// <param name="view">GridView</param>
        /// <param name="rowIndex">rowIndex</param>
        /// <param name="visibleColumnsIndex">visibleColumnsIndex</param>
        /// <returns>单元格值</returns>
        public static object GetRowCellValue(this GridView view, int rowIndex, int visibleColumnsIndex)
        {
            return view.GetRowCellValue(rowIndex, view.VisibleColumns[visibleColumnsIndex]);
        }

.csharpcode, .csharpcode pre
{
font-size: small;
color: black;
font-family: consolas, "Courier New", courier, monospace;
background-color: #ffffff;
/*white-space: pre;*/
}
.csharpcode pre { margin: 0em; }
.csharpcode .rem { color: #008000; }
.csharpcode .kwrd { color: #0000ff; }
.csharpcode .str { color: #006080; }
.csharpcode .op { color: #0000c0; }
.csharpcode .preproc { color: #cc6633; }
.csharpcode .asp { background-color: #ffff00; }
.csharpcode .html { color: #800000; }
.csharpcode .attr { color: #ff0000; }
.csharpcode .alt
{
background-color: #f4f4f4;
width: 100%;
margin: 0em;
}
.csharpcode .lnum { color: #606060; }希望有所帮助!

[DevExpress]GridControl 根据RowIndex和VisibleColumnsIndex来获取单元格值,布布扣,bubuko.com

时间: 2024-10-25 07:57:57

[DevExpress]GridControl 根据RowIndex和VisibleColumnsIndex来获取单元格值的相关文章

DevExpress gridview获取单元格坐标

获取坐标(在RowCellClick事件中)的代码如下: private void gridView1_RowCellClick(object sender, DevExpress.XtraGrid.Views.Grid.RowCellClickEventArgs e) { //获取点击单元格左上角的坐标 GridViewInfo info = gridView1.GetViewInfo() as GridViewInfo; GridCellInfo cellInfo = info.GetGri

POI教程之第二讲:创建一个时间格式的单元格,处理不同内容格式的单元格,遍历工作簿的行和列并获取单元格内容,文本提取

第二讲 1.创建一个时间格式的单元格 Workbook wb=new HSSFWorkbook(); // 定义一个新的工作簿 Sheet sheet=wb.createSheet("第一个Sheet页"); // 创建第一个Sheet页 //第一个单元格 Row row=sheet.createRow(0); // 创建一个行 Cell cell=row.createCell(0); // 创建一个单元格 第1列 cell.setCellValue(new Date()); // 给

浅谈DevExpress&lt;五&gt;:TreeList简单的美化——自定义单元格,加注释以及行序号

今天就以昨天的列表为例,实现以下效果:预算大于110万的单元格突出显示,加上行序号以及注释,如下图: 添加行序号要用到CustomDrawNodeIndicator方法,要注意的是,取得的节点索引是从0开始的,所以要+1以便第一行从一开始算起. private void treeList1_CustomDrawNodeIndicator(object sender, CustomDrawNodeIndicatorEventArgs e) { TreeList tree = sender as D

POI读取excel单元格,获取单元格各类型值,返回字符串类型

package a; import java.io.FileInputStream; import java.io.IOException; import java.io.InputStream; import java.text.DecimalFormat; import org.apache.commons.lang3.StringUtils; import org.apache.poi.hssf.usermodel.HSSFDateUtil; import org.apache.poi.h

FineReport——获取控件值和单元格值

设置单元格的值(填报预览): //contentPane.setCellValue(1,0,"abc"); contentPane.curLGP.setCellValue(1, 0, "abc") 获取单元格的值(填报预览): //contentPane.getCellValue(1,0); contentPane.curLGP.getCellValue(1, 0) 获取父模板: var form = window.parent.form; 获取/设置制定参数控件的

NPOI 获取单元格的值

1.日期格式的坑 var cell = row.GetCell(i);//获取某一个单元格 var value = ""; if (cell != null) { if (cell.CellType == CellType.Numeric)//当单元格格式是数值或者日期的时候,CellType==Numeric { value = cell.ToString();//如果是数值还好,如果是日期类型的话,直接获取的值是不正确的 if (DateUtil.IsCellDateFormatt

gridControl单元格的值随另一个单元格值的改变而改变

private void grvDetail_CellValueChanged(object sender, DevExpress.XtraGrid.Views.Base.CellValueChangedEventArgs e) { if (grvDetail.RowCount > 0 && e.RowHandle >= 0) { if (grvDetail.FocusedColumn.FieldName == "partQty" || grvDetail.

wpf datagrid根据多选选中的获取单元格内容,进行操作数据

private void Button_Click(object sender, RoutedEventArgs e)        {            var vLst = this.dgList.SelectedItems;            for (int i = 0; i < vLst.Count; i++)            { 1.//获取选中的数据                string str = (dgList.Columns[1].GetCellConte

[VBA] excel获取单元格的超链接地址函数

Function geturl(c As Range) As String geturl = c.Hyperlinks(1).Address End Function 设置超链接的函数是HYPERLINK.